The United States Department of Labor, Office of the Solicitor seeks a trial attorney to join the San Francisco Regional Office for a one-year term position. The position may be based in either the San Francisco or Los Angeles sub-Regional office. The term attorney will litigate a variety of wage and hour matters on behalf of the government, including matters arising under the Fair Labor Standards Act, the Davis Bacon Act, and matters arising out of the various H visa programs for which the Secretary has been assigned responsibility pursuant to the Immigration and Nationality Act, as amended. This work includes, but is not limited to, pre-referral assistance, litigation of an increased number of H cases, and assisting the Wage-Hour Division with reviewing pending cases. Demonstrated interest in public interest law and/or experience with employment laws and/or vulnerable worker populations is desirable. Ability to speak a second language spoken by communities served by the Department is strongly preferred. Starting salary is commensurate with experience and includes benefits. Salary range is GS-11 to GS-14. Must be active member of the Bar in any U.S. State or U.S. Territory Court under the U.S. Constitution.
